The Single Woman’s Dash of Sass: Your Destiny is Too Big for Small People!

Quote of the Day:

One resolution I have made, and try always to keep, is this: To rise above the little things. ~John Burroughs

The Single Woman Says:

This is the last week before Christmas…the year is winding down…and I want to take the next several days to focus not on where we’ve been, but where we’re going. What can we do BETTER in 2012? What can we put behind us to make room for all the good stuff to find us? No matter what happened in 2011, the new year offers the opportunity to start again, better and wiser. Today’s quote celebrates rising above. Not letting little people distract you from your BIG purpose. As 2011 comes to a close, I urge you to stop sweating the stuff and the people you should be forgetting. Life becomes a breeze once you stop sweatin’ other people! Resolve in 2012 to evolve past small people, small minds, and small opinions. There will always be petty people throwing their stones, but instead of letting them break your heart OR your bones, I urge you to use them to build a more solid foundation.
